Guardian/Conservator Association of Oregon

Guardian/Conservator Association of Oregon GCA is a non-profit organization, incorporated in 1988. We support professional fiduciaries throughout Oregon with education, training, and mentorship.

Quarterly GCA Conference
REGISTRATION REMINDER

**REGISTRATION CLOSES 4/30/2026**

REGISTER HERE!!! GCA Conference 5/8/2026

Conference Details:
May 8, 2026
Providence Willamette Falls Community Center
519 15th Street, Oregon City, OR 97045
Virtual Option available as well

Schedule:
8am - Breakfast
8:30 Member Meeting
9:30 - AARP Presentation
1045 - 11 Break
11-12:30 - Medical Ethics Presentation


Presentation Information:

1. AARP ‘HomeFit’ Program - guidelines on age-friendly housing. We will hear how home modifications will enhance seniors’ safety and comfort in an age when current housing stock doesn’t suit our elders’ needs. Keeping clients at home is a ‘least restrictive alternative’ if it can be done safely and within cost parameters.

2. Erleen Whitney, PhD. will lead us in an important session about medical ethics as applied to our vulnerable clients. After learning some basic ‘pillars’ of ethics, we will break into discussion groups to review the elements of a sticky (true) case history.
